Comparison Summary

1. Specifications Comparison

FeatureMotorola Moto G14Sony Xperia 5 VPractical Impact
Design
Dimensions161.5 x 73.8 x 8 mm154 x 68 x 8.6 mmXperia 5 V is noticeably narrower and slightly shorter, making it more pocketable and comfortable for one-handed use.
Weight177g182gThe weight difference is negligible in real-world usage.
Display
Display TypeIPS LCDOLED, 1B colors, 120Hz, HDR10, BT.2020The Xperia 5 V's OLED offers significantly better contrast, deeper blacks, and more vibrant colors. The 120Hz refresh rate delivers smoother animations and scrolling. HDR10 and BT.2020 support provide a wider color gamut for richer visuals.
Display Size6.5"6.1"The Moto G14 offers a slightly larger screen for media consumption, but the size difference isn't substantial.
Resolution1080 x 24001080 x 2520Similar pixel density, resulting in comparable sharpness. Xperia 5 V's slightly taller aspect ratio is better suited for browsing and reading.
Refresh RateNot specified120HzA higher refresh rate on the Xperia 5 V translates to a smoother and more responsive user experience. The lack of specification for the Moto G14 suggests a standard 60Hz, leading to a less fluid experience.
Performance
ChipsetUnisoc Tiger T616 (12 nm)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 (4 nm)The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 in the Xperia 5 V is significantly more powerful, enabling smoother multitasking, faster app loading, and better gaming performance. The Unisoc T616 is a budget chipset designed for basic tasks.
CPUOcta-core (2x2.0 GHz Cortex-A75 & 6x1.8 GHz Cortex-A55)Octa-core (1x3.2 GHz Cortex-X3 & 2x2.8 GHz Cortex-A715 & 2x2.8 GHz Cortex-A710 & 3x2.0 GHz Cortex-A510)The Xperia 5 V's CPU architecture and clock speeds are superior, resulting in a vastly more powerful and efficient device.
GPUMali-G57 MP1Adreno 740The Adreno 740 offers dramatically better graphics performance for demanding games and applications.
RAM8GB8GBBoth phones have the same amount of RAM, which is sufficient for multitasking. However, the superior CPU and overall performance of the Xperia 5 V will make multitasking feel smoother.
Storage256GB256GBBoth phones offer the same storage capacity.
Camera
Video Capabilities1080p@30fps4K@120fps (HDR, OIS, EIS), ...The Xperia 5 V boasts significantly superior video recording capabilities, including 4K resolution at high frame rates, HDR, and stabilization. This allows for professional-grade video capture.
Battery
Capacity5000 mAh5000 mAhBoth phones have the same battery capacity. However, the Xperia 5 V's more efficient processor might result in better battery life despite the 120Hz display.

2. Key Differences Analysis

Motorola Moto G14 Advantages:

  • Lower Price: Positioned in the "low price" range, it offers a budget-friendly option.

Sony Xperia 5 V Advantages:

  • Superior Performance: The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 provides a flagship-level experience.
  • High-Quality Display: The OLED display with a 120Hz refresh rate delivers vibrant visuals and smooth interactions.
  • Advanced Camera Features: Offers professional-grade video recording capabilities.
  • More Compact Design: Easier to handle and carry in pockets.

Trade-offs:

  • Price: The Xperia 5 V is significantly more expensive.
  • Battery Life: While both have the same capacity, the Xperia 5 V's 120Hz display could potentially drain the battery faster. Real-world usage will vary.

3. User Profiles & Recommendations

Motorola Moto G14: Budget-conscious users who prioritize basic functionality: calling, texting, web browsing, and light social media usage. Suitable for users who don't play demanding games or require high-end features.

Sony Xperia 5 V: Users who demand top-tier performance, a premium display, and advanced camera capabilities. Ideal for mobile gamers, content creators, and those who value a smooth and responsive user experience.
